This Saturday night, December 12, I'll be moderating a Q&A with director Jane Campion and actress Abbie Cornish at the American Cinematheque's Aero Theatre. We'll be showing one of my favorite movies of 2009, BRIGHT STAR, followed by the Q&A and a screening of Campion's breakthrough film SWEETIE. Also, the following Wednesday the Aero will be doing a sneak preview of LOSS OF A TEARDROP DIAMOND, starring Bryce Dallas Howard, who will be there in person for yet another Q&A with yours truly. This Thursday night, November 19, I'll be moderating a Q&A with the great Paul Mazursky at the American Cinematheque's Aero Theatre in Santa Monica. We're showing two terrific movies, AN UNMARRIED WOMAN and TEMPEST, and in between films I'll be interviewing Mazursky on stage. On Friday, September 11, I'll be moderating a Q&A with one of my favorite American directors, Peter Bogdanovich, at the American Cinematheque's Egyptian theatre in Hollywood. We'll be watching 35mm prints of two Bogdanovich classics, NICKELODEON and MASK, with my conversation with the filmmaker between the movies.
